1212PLC MODBUS/TCP MB-CLIENT偏移量计算

还有一个问题:在功能码0X04,温度终端地址:0x00~0044,其第一个寄存器地址是30065,使用MB-CLIENT指令进行编程,计算出的1212PLC第一个对应地址是DBW32
A) 请问也是DB2.DBW32吗?
B) 在ARRAY数组时的偏移量是:10.0、12.0、14.0、16.0、18.0, 是否下个地址是DB2.DBW34(偏移量是12.0)、DBW36(偏移量是14.0)、如此类推?
C) 在进行ARRAY[0..4]数组中定义是“WORD”,但在每个元素的数据类型如何定义?温度终端所发来的是“16位的 WORD”的数据类型?

图片说明:

1212PLC MODBUS/TCP MB-CLIENT偏移量计算    1212PLC MODBUS/TCP MB-CLIENT偏移量计算    1212PLC MODBUS/TCP MB-CLIENT偏移量计算   

最佳答案

你的程序时读取5个输入字,即30065对应DB2.DBW0,30066对应DB2.DBW2,依此类推。
数组中定义是“WORD”,在数组下的每个元素的数据类型也就为“WORD”了。

提问者对于答案的评价:
谢谢回复,从DB2.DBW0开始的数据块定义,如果是用ARRAY数组来定义的话,上机操作时第一个数组的数据是从DB2.DBW10开始。

专家置评

已阅,最佳答案正确。

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c186857.html

(2)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2017年7月25日 下午10:46
下一篇 2017年7月25日 下午10:46

相关推荐

  • 1200下载时DB丢失的问题

    1.请问1200如何仅下载程序,不下载数据,每次下载时,DB里面的数据有的会丢失;2.DB数据能能上传保存到电脑,如果能的话,该如何操作; 最佳答案 1、如果你数据块有改动的话(添…

    2017年6月18日
  • VMWARE虚拟机中TIA V13 SP1明显卡顿

    请问各位老师有没有遇到过以下情况:1、在WIN10系统中安装VMWARE虚拟机,在虚拟机中安装64位WIN7旗舰版,然后在WIN7中安装TIA V13 SP12…

    2017年6月4日
  • 西门子TIA-V12简体中文版软件疑问

    学习西门子2009出版的S71200间以太网通信教材中,有定义接收数据块时“选择仅符号寻址”。但我在TIA-V12简体中文版软件中没有这个选项,而只有手动和自动两个选项。不知是啥原…

    2017年6月5日
  • 怎么使用DTL数据类型

    大家好,请教个问题:读取时间的输出指向某个DTL类型的数据,假如我有个名叫TIME的DTL数据,放在DB0里面,那么在指令的输出管脚该怎么表示这个地址呢?如果我想用TIME的年或者…

    SIMATIC S7-1200 2017年8月24日
  • TIA Portal 中的PID_compact提示版本过时

    在用博图软件做个PID实验时,将PLC程序全部编译提示:The version of PID_Compact used is&nb…

    SIMATIC S7-1200 2017年8月26日
  • S1200以太网组态?

    一套系统,威纶通触摸屏一台,S7-1200三台,走以太网通讯,请问在PortalV11软件下的 设备和网络→拓扑视图 威纶通的触摸屏需要要添加组态吗?要组态哪一…

    SIMATIC S7-1200 2017年11月12日
  • S7-1200编程电缆

    s7-1200除了PC适配器的话,还可以用哪些编程电缆对起传送程序,可否用PPI协议?还是需要再添加什么模块?谢谢 最佳答案 S7-1200走的是PROFINET &nb…

    SIMATIC S7-1200 2017年11月19日
  • S7-1212 PLC MODBUS/TCP MB-SERVER 指令

    请教:使用S7-1212 PLC 进行对一台温度终端进行监控,这台温度终端是按MODBUS/TCP进行通讯,它的地址:0X0040~0044,数据类型:1&nb…

    2017年7月25日
  • s7 1200使用哪个版本的软件

    最近采购了一台最新的S7 1200PLC,订货号为 6ES7 214-1BG40-0XB0,德国原产,请问要对其编程组态,使用的软件版本最低应该是那个…

    SIMATIC S7-1200 2017年8月18日
  • S7-1200在博途软件中调用S7-300中的FB41 CONT_C

    如何在博途软件中添加这个块进去,不要说自身的PID_COMPACT和PID_3STEP。是问如何使用S7300中的这个CONT_C这个块。 最佳答案 CONT_C是专门为300和4…

    SIMATIC S7-1200 2017年8月24日